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,324,779,066
Lastest Block:
1,962,052
Utxos:
1,983,745
Nodes:
349
OmniXEP Contracts:
274
Block details
[STAKE]
09/02/2025 15:31:28 UTC
Txid
5df14da6bb417d80065406f1693e26eb8658c844c702a6028500d557cda6ddae
Block
1,626,510
Block hash
a627a2f11c9144ae97583183e92bb30d4c260604193064d4c6a598ae94e4b85c
Stake amount
230.36494233 XEP
Sender
ep1qwx9xf68mw58pt6xwemafr7vx98c6fqdaje6cer
Recipient
ep1q2a33ztuzdupshs7wu7t7cxd8hr5gpmtjwrg94q
(2,023,344.59853823 XEP)